Liege's biggest local history museum reopens
Liege, Belgium - The local history museum in Liege has reopened to the public after a four-year renovation.
The museum is the largest of its kind in Liege and has a total of 260,000 items in its collection. Last September, work was completed on its new home in a former Franciscan monastery.
The museum has completely reorganised its exhibition space, according to the Belgian Tourist office. Among the treasures on display is a collection of astrolabes and sun dials. (dpa)
